Since 1987, the New York office of Arnold & Porter LLP has vigorously grown to keep up with the changing demands of businesses and individuals in a variety of geographic markets. With more than 100 attorneys in one of the most distinguished legal and financial centers in the world, we provide a wide range of services including Litigation, Corporate and Securities, Product Liability and Mass Tort Litigation, Intellectual Property, Real Estate and Environmental.

We have significant strength in complex litigation, investigations work, and financial services transactions. New York-based attorneys have been actively involved in some of the highest profile legal matters of the day, including the Madoff litigation, the AIG Credit Facility Trust matter, and apartheid reparations. Attorneys in the New York office worked on several of the most notable transactions of 2011 involving financial services companies, including representation of State Bancorp in its acquisition by Valley Bancorp and representation of Aurora Bank, FSB in its sale by the Lehman Brothers bankruptcy estate. Attorneys from the firm's financial services team advised Banco do Brasil on the corporate, regulatory, and tax aspects of its acquisition of Florida-based EuroBank.
